Introduction
This manual provides instructions for the installation and operation of your Intel Centrino 2230 Mini PCI Express Wi-Fi/Bluetooth Combo Adapter. This adapter integrates both Wi-Fi (802.11n) and Bluetooth 4.0 capabilities into a single Mini PCI Express card, designed for compatible laptop systems.
Important Compatibility Note: This adapter does NOT support HP and Lenovo computers due to specific hardware whitelists implemented by these manufacturers. Please verify your system's compatibility before installation.

Configuration et installation
1. Vérifications préalables à l'installation
- Compatibilité: Ensure your laptop has a Mini PCI Express slot and is not an HP or Lenovo model. Refer to your laptop's service manual for slot location and compatibility.
- Outils: You will typically need a small Phillips head screwdriver.
- Conducteurs : It is recommended to download the latest drivers for the Intel Centrino 2230 from the official Intel support website onto a USB drive before starting the installation. Rechercher "Intel Centrino Wireless-N 2230 drivers".
2. Installation physique
- Éteindre: Shut down your laptop completely and disconnect the power adapter and battery.
- Panneau d'accès: Locate and remove the access panel on the bottom of your laptop that covers the Mini PCI Express slot. Consult your laptop's service manual for exact instructions.
- Retirer l'ancienne carte (le cas échéant) : If replacing an existing Wi-Fi card, carefully disconnect the antenna cables (MAIN and AUX) and remove the screw securing the card. The card should pop up slightly, allowing you to slide it out.
- Insérer une nouvelle carte : Align the Intel Centrino 2230 adapter with the Mini PCI Express slot. Gently push the card into the slot at an angle until it is fully seated.
- Carte sécurisée : Push the card down and secure it with the screw.
- Connecter les antennes : Carefully connect the antenna cables to the corresponding connectors on the adapter. The main antenna typically connects to the "MAIN" (1) connector, and the auxiliary antenna to the "AUX" (2) connector. These are small, delicate connectors; apply gentle, even pressure until they click into place.

Image: Intel Centrino 2230 Mini PCI Express Wi-Fi/Bluetooth Combo Adapter. The image displays the top side of the card, highlighting the "MAIN" (1) and "AUX" (2) antenna connectors, the Intel logo, and the model number "2230BNHMW" clearly printed on the label.
- Remonter: Replace the access panel and reconnect the battery and power adapter.

Dépannage
- Adapter not detected or not working:
- Ensure the card is fully seated in the Mini PCI Express slot and secured with a screw.
- Verify that the antenna cables are securely connected to the "MAIN" and "AUX" ports on the adapter.
- Check Device Manager (Windows) to see if the device is listed. If there are yellow exclamation marks, drivers may be missing or corrupted.
- Reinstall the drivers from the Intel support website.
- Pour les utilisateurs de Windows 10 : Some users have reported issues with this specific card on Windows 10, including dropped connections or the card disappearing. Ensure you have the absolute latest drivers directly from Intel, not generic Windows drivers.
- Confirm your laptop is not an HP or Lenovo model, as these are known to have compatibility restrictions.

Caractéristiques
| Numéro de modèle | 2230BNHMW |
| Type sans fil | Norme IEEE 802.11b/g/n |
| Taux de transfert de données | Up to 300 Mbps (Wi-Fi) |
| Version Bluetooth | Bluetooth 4.0 |
| Interface | Mini-PCI Express |
| Dimensions (L x l x H) | 2.9 x 2 x 1.1 pouces (environ) |
| Poids | 0.16 ounces / 4.54 g (approximate) |
